Wireless Keyboard · I picked up one of the Apple Bluetooth models and let me tell you, this is one slick product. A little bit more fuss & bother to get going the first time than a typical wireless that talks to a USB dongle, but once you’ve got it going, it’s your typical Macintosh “turn it on and it works” experience. I really like my PowerBook, but having those extra keys (home, end, page-up, page-down, all the usual stuff) just makes everything go faster and better. Stingy on desk-space too. Highly recommended. But, you know, Apple could easily fit a few more keys on top of this great big honkin’ laptop.
